ANNIE "JEWEL" POLK
Annie "Jewel" Polk, age 89, of Raymore, Missouri passed away peacefully on December 16, 2025, at the Foxwood Springs Living Center.
A Celebration of Jewel's life will be held at a later date.
Jewel was born in Henderson, Texas on July 8, 1936, the daughter of Walter F. Gray and Elener Wright. Jewel attended various schools in East Texas. Shortly after high school, Jewel met Erly B. Polk, and they were later married on June 22, 1958, in Saint Joseph, Missouri. Together, they were blessed with two wonderful sons, Erly D. and Reginald L. In life Jewel worked a few different careers. She was the lead cook at the State Hospital in Saint Joseph, later the lead cook at the Buchanan County Sheriff's Department in Saint Joseph and worked at and managed the well-known Four Aces Barbeque restaurant in Saint Joseph owned by her and husband Erly B along with the help of their two sons for 25 years. Upon retiring in 2001, she and Erly moved back to Texas to care for her mother and father. They returned to Missouri in 2017 and made their home in Raymore to be closer to their sons.
Jewel was preceded in death by her parents, Walter and Elener Gray; four sisters, infant Emma Gray, Frances Ross, Betty Johnson and Rose Gray.
She is survived by her loving husband of 67 years, Erly B. Polk; her two sons, Erly D. Polk and Reginald "Reggie" Polk (LaRae); two brothers, Dennis Gray and Lester Gray (Faye); two sisters, Nellie Wesley and Marcie Simmons (Tim); three grandchildren, Jerry Polk ( Missy) , Ashley Polk, and Erly "EJ" Polk; eight great grandchildren and numerous other relatives and friends.
